When Culture Starts to Rot
This is what we see when fear replaces trust and psychological safety:
- Managers lie to their teams to appease senior leaders and lose trust when the truth comes out.

- Mistakes and problems are hidden, blame is passed, and perfection becomes the only safe option.
- Leaders posture as heroes who have all the answers instead of showing vulnerability or their human side.
- Unethical behaviour is tolerated if it drives profit and new business.
- HR turns a blind eye to bullying, harassment and discrimination. Policies are applied unevenly.
- Microaggressions are dismissed as “banter” and victims labelled troublemakers.
- Burnout becomes a badge of honour. Mental health issues rise. Sick leave skyrockets.
- New hires realise they were sold a story and want out (before probation is over!).
- Diversity, Equity & Inclusion (DEI) becomes performative, untethered from power or accountability.
- Leadership stays white and male. No urgency to change.
- Gossip, favouritism, information hoarding and cliques flourish with infrequent communication, such as company meetings or 1:1s.
And the Impact
- You lose your best people, the diverse talent, trusted leaders, top performers. Gone.
- Productivity tanks. People are resisting, disengaged and demotivated. Change stalls.
- Innovation dries up. No one’s taking risks or experimenting with new ideas.
- Customers churn. Quality slips.
- Your reputation erodes. Legal risks rise.
- Smart people are hired, paid but are too stressed to perform. Diverse views rarely included. A poor return on investment.
The mission is buried under politics, silence, and fear.

Why Leaders Can’t See It
The truth?
Leaders rarely hear what employees really experience and think.
Power dynamics and distance from the “front line” distort the feedback.
Exit interviews rarely happen, and when they do, they sugar-coat the issues.
And senior teams become out of touch.
